Panthers Fall 1-0 as they Allow Goal in First Minute of Overtime

ANN ARBOR, Mich. - DU's chances of finishing in the top four in the WHAC took a hit today as they allowed a goal in the first minute of overtime in a 1-0 loss to Concordia in Ann Arbor. Davenport is now 5-8 on the year and will host SVSU on Sunday in a non-conference game at 2:00 PM.

Davenport came into Saturday's game hoping to get back on the winning track but could not muster any offense for the second straight game as they fell 1-0 to the Cardinals.

The Panthers finished with 13 total shots but only two on net as the Cardinals converted one of their two shots on net at the 90:52 mark in the first overtime.

James Gilpin (Newcastle, UK) took the loss in net as DU will now host Saginaw Valley State in a non-conference game on Sunday at 2:00 PM.
